Women’s health physiotherapy encompasses a wide range of services aimed at improving physical health and quality of life for women. One of the key areas we focus on is pelvic floor physiotherapy therapy, which is crucial for maintaining pelvic health and managing conditions that can significantly impact daily life. The pelvic floor is a group of muscles and tissues that support the bladder, uterus, and rectum. Dysfunction in these muscles can lead to various issues such as urinary incontinence, pelvic pain, and prolapse.

Comprehensive Assessment for Pelvic Floor Physiotherapy

Our approach to women’s health and pelvic floor physiotherapy begins with a comprehensive assessment. This includes a detailed medical history, physical examination, and, if necessary, specialized tests to understand the extent and nature of the pelvic floor dysfunction. Our experienced physiotherapists are trained to conduct these assessments with the utmost sensitivity and professionalism, ensuring your comfort and dignity at all times.

Pelvic Floor Physiotherapy Treatment

Based on the assessment, we develop a personalized treatment plan tailored to your specific needs and goals. Our pelvic floor physiotherapy techniques include:

  • Pelvic Floor Exercises: Also known as Kegel exercises, these help to strengthen the pelvic floor muscles and improve their function. This is a key component of pelvic floor muscle physiotherapy.
  • Biofeedback: This technique uses special devices to help you become aware of and control your pelvic floor muscles.
  • Manual Therapy: Hands-on techniques to release muscle tension, improve tissue mobility, and alleviate pain.
  • Education and Lifestyle Modifications: Guidance on bladder and bowel habits, posture, and lifestyle changes to support pelvic health.

Benefits of Pelvic Floor Physiotherapy

Pelvic floor physiotherapy provides significant benefits for individuals experiencing pelvic health issues. Whether addressing existing concerns or providing preventive care, this therapy supports overall pelvic function and well-being. Key benefits include:

  • Enhanced pelvic floor muscle function and strength through targeted pelvic muscle retraining

  • Improved urinary and bowel control, reducing symptoms of incontinence

  • Relief from pelvic pain, including painful bladder syndrome and Interstitial Cystitis

  • Effective recovery and management of chronic pelvic pain

  • Treatment of sexual dysfunction related to pelvic floor muscle dysfunction

  • Support in preparing the body for childbirth through prenatal physiotherapy

  • Assistance with postpartum care and recovery, including muscle rehabilitation

  • Prevention and management of pelvic organ prolapse

  • Improved muscle performance during daily tasks and physical activity
